Lee’s Summit Fireworks Regulations for Fourth of July Thursday, June 24, 2021 | Views: 8758 | Categories: Fire Department Press Releases In the City of Lee’s Summit, residents with a fireworks permit may discharge approved fireworks on July 3 from 10 a.m. to 11 p.m.; July 4 from 10 a.m. to midnight; and July 5 from 10 a.m. to 11 p.m. within city limits. A fireworks permit is free and can be obtained at City Hall, approved consumer fireworks tents or the City’s website.
